Discover the joy behind the Hail Mary as a heartfelt tribute to the Blessed Mother. Fr. Mark-Mary explores the Biblical origins of ‘Blessed are you among women’ from Luke’s Visitation. Learn how Mary’s greeting of Elizabeth brought grace, igniting a Spirit-filled exclamation from Elizabeth. Embrace a childlike wonder through a delightful dolphin story that embodies joy. Renew the meaning of the Hail Mary into a vibrant cry of praise and engage in heartfelt prayer to celebrate Mary and Jesus.

Mary's Greeting Communicates Grace

  • Mary's greeting transmits grace and the Holy Spirit to Elizabeth in the Visitation account.
  • Fr. Mark-Mary says this shows Mary effectively communicates Jesus and sanctifying grace by her presence.
INSIGHT

Awe At God's Humility

  • The humility of God is shown by Jesus becoming small enough to be carried in Mary's womb.
  • Fr. Mark-Mary invites awe at this mystery and at Mary's role in carrying Jesus.
